Yayoi Kusama comes to San Francisco 

The wait is finally over! We had the pleasure to attend opening day of the Yayoi Kusama exhibit at the SFMOMA, and we love to share our experiences with our E7S family. 

This is Kusama’s first solo presentation in Northern California and we are still boasting with excitement from having an opportunity to explore the work of this world renowned artist. 

The installation of two Infinity Mirror Rooms are magical and allowed us to be fully immersed in Kusama’s world: “Dreaming of Earth’s Sphericity, I Would Offer My Love” and “Love Is Calling”

We appreciate her usage of light and color within these immersive spaces. In one room, you will hear Kusama’s voice reciting a poem about love, it feels as if you’re having an in person conversation with the artist. 

There’s also a massive bronze sculpture, “Aspiring to Pumpkin’s Love, the Love in My Heart” that takes up an entire room in the museum. Kusama’s iconic patterns shimmered with the yellow and black urethane coating basing the entire sculpture. 

For Kusama, polka dots represent self-obliteration. Not in a destructively but the idea of merging the individual with the larger universe; a symbol which embodies peace and joy.
